The Rise of the Robots: Are Robotic Vacuum Cleaners Worth It for UK Homes?

The hum of a vacuum cleaner was once an inevitable weekend soundtrack in households throughout the UK. But times are changing. A new generation of cleaning home appliance has emerged, guaranteeing to liberate us from the chore of vacuuming: the robotic vacuum. These autonomous devices are no longer a futuristic dream, but a readily available and increasingly popular solution for maintaining clean floorings in contemporary British homes.

Robotic vacuum have evolved substantially given that their initial entry into the marketplace. Early models were typically criticised for mishandling, vulnerable to getting stuck, and possessing limited cleaning capabilities. Today, however, advancements in technology have actually resulted in sophisticated makers that can browse complicated layouts, effectively remove dirt and particles, and even find out the layout of your home for ideal cleaning. For hectic people, families managing several dedications, or those looking for to simplify their cleaning routine, robotic vacuum use a compelling proposition. However are they genuinely worth the investment for UK homes? Let's delve into the world of robotic vacuum and explore their benefits, considerations, and whether they are the ideal cleaning companion for you.

The Allure of Automation: Benefits of Robotic Vacuum Cleaners

The primary appeal of a robotic vacuum depend on its sheer benefit. Envision coming home to freshly vacuumed floorings without lifting a finger. This is the core pledge, and one that sounds real for numerous users. But the advantages extend beyond simple convenience:

  • Time Saving and Effortless Cleaning: This is the most apparent advantage. Robotic vacuum cleaners automate a lengthy task, freeing up valuable hours for work, leisure, or household time. Simply set a schedule or start cleaning with an app, and the robot vacuum cleaner uk looks after the rest.
  • Constant Cleaning: Robotic vacuums can be configured to clean daily, or perhaps numerous times a day, making sure a regularly clean home. This is especially advantageous for homes with animals or allergies, where routine dust and irritant elimination is crucial.
  • Reaches Difficult Areas: Many robotic vacuum are developed to navigate under furniture and into corners that are frequently challenging to reach with conventional vacuums. This ensures a more extensive clean across the entire floor surface.
  • Smart Home Integration: Modern robotic vacuums typically boast smart functions like Wi-Fi connection, smart device app control, voice assistant compatibility (Amazon Alexa, Google Assistant), and the ability to map your home. This permits remote control, tailored cleaning schedules, and even targeted cleaning of particular rooms.
  • Range of Models and Features: From fundamental affordable designs to high-end machines with advanced functions like mopping, self-emptying dustbins, and barrier avoidance, there's a robotic vacuum cleaner to fit various requirements and budgets.
  • Decreased Noise Levels (Often): While not all robotic vacuums are quiet, lots of designs run at a lower noise level compared to traditional upright or cylinder vacuums. This enables cleaning to occur without being excessively disruptive.

Navigating the marketplace: Key Considerations When Choosing a Robotic Vacuum Cleaner in the UK

The UK market uses a huge selection of robotic vacuum options, each with differing functions and rate points. To make an informed choice, consider these crucial factors:

  • Suction Power: This determines how successfully the robot will pick up dirt, dust, and debris. Houses with carpets or rugs will gain from models with greater suction power. Search for specifications on air watts (AW) or pascal (Pa) ratings as indicators of suction strength.
  • Battery Life and Coverage: Consider the size of your home. Bigger homes will require robots with longer battery life to guarantee they can complete a cleaning cycle without requiring to recharge mid-clean. Check the manufacturer's requirements for battery run time and estimated cleaning area protection.
  • Navigation System:
    • Random Bounce Navigation: Simpler, older designs browse randomly, bouncing off challenges up until they cover the location. Less efficient and might miss out on spots.
    • Systematic Navigation (Gyro or Camera-Based): More innovative designs use gyroscopes or cameras to map your home and tidy in methodical patterns (e.g., backward and forward rows). More effective and thorough cleaning.
    • LiDAR (Laser-Based Navigation): The most advanced systems utilize lasers to develop extremely accurate maps, offering precise navigation and challenge avoidance, even in low-light conditions.
  • Functions & & Functionality:
    • Mopping Function: Some models use a mopping function, either through a wet fabric attachment or a devoted water tank. Think about if you need a 2-in-1 vacuum and mop.
    • Smart Home Integration: If you utilize smart home assistants, ensure compatibility with your preferred platform (Alexa, Google Assistant).
    • Boundary Strips or Virtual Walls: These permit you to limit the robot's cleaning area, avoiding it from getting in specific spaces or areas.
    • Self-Emptying Dustbins: High-end designs feature self-emptying bases that instantly empty the robot's dustbin into a larger container, reducing the frequency of manual emptying.
    • Pet Hair Handling: If you have animals, search for designs particularly created to handle pet hair, often including tangle-free brushes and more powerful suction.
  • Floor Type Compatibility: Consider the dominant floor covering enter your home. Some robots are much better matched for difficult floors, while others excel on carpets. Check specifications for compatibility with various floor types (wood, tile, carpet, rugs).
  • Noise Level: If sound is a concern, inspect the decibel (dB) ranking of the vacuum. Lower dB rankings indicate quieter operation.
  • Price and Budget: Robotic vacuum cleaners vary in rate from affordable to premium designs. Identify your budget plan and focus on the features that are most essential to you.
  • Upkeep and Durability: Consider the ease of maintenance, such as filter cleaning or brush replacement. Read evaluations regarding the long-term toughness of the model.

Keeping Your Robot Rolling: Usage and Maintenance Tips

To guarantee your robotic vacuum cleaner carries out optimally and takes pleasure in a long life expectancy, follow these use and upkeep pointers:

  • Prepare Your Home: Before the very first tidy, clean up loose wires, little objects, and anything the robot might get tangled in.
  • Routinely Empty the Dustbin: Empty the dustbin after each cleaning cycle, or as needed, to keep ideal suction.
  • Clean Brushes and Filters: Regularly clean the brushes and filters according to the maker's instructions. This prevents blockages and maintains cleaning efficiency.
  • Inspect for Obstructions: Periodically examine the robot's wheels and brushes for hair or particles accumulation and eliminate any obstructions.
  • Replace Filters and Brushes: Replace filters and brushes as suggested by the producer to guarantee ideal performance.
  • Follow Charging Instructions: Keep the charging dock available and follow the maker's standards for charging and battery upkeep.

Are Robotic Vacuum Cleaners Worth the Investment for UK Homes?

For numerous UK homes, the response is a resounding yes. Robotic vacuum cleaners offer a substantial upgrade in benefit and time-saving for hectic way of lives. While the preliminary investment can appear significant, the long-lasting advantages of automated cleaning, constant floor upkeep, and freed-up time typically surpass the expense.

However, robotic vacuums aren't a total replacement for standard deep cleaning. For greatly stained locations or deep carpet cleaning, a conventional vacuum might still be required. In addition, lower-end designs may fight with intricate designs or need more intervention.

Ultimately, the "worth" of a robotic vacuum cleaner depends on specific needs and circumstances. If you value benefit, desire to automate your cleaning routine, and are prepared to buy a gadget that lines up with your home's layout and cleaning requirements, then a robotic vacuum can be an invaluable addition to your UK home.

Regularly Asked Questions (FAQs)

  • Q: Can robotic vacuum really replace conventional vacuums?
    • A: For regular upkeep cleaning, yes, robotic vacuums are highly effective and can substantially reduce the requirement for traditional vacuuming. Nevertheless, for deep cleans up or heavily soiled areas, a standard Automatic Vacuum And Mop Robot may still be needed.
  • Q: Are robotic automatic vacuum and mop robot suitable for homes with animals?
    • A: Yes, numerous robotic vacuum are designed particularly for pet hair, featuring stronger suction and tangle-free brushes. Try to find designs marketed as "pet-friendly."
  • Q: Do robotic vacuum deal with carpets?
    • A: Yes, numerous models work on carpets, but performance varies. For thicker carpets, choose models with higher suction power and functions designed for carpet cleaning.
  • Q: How long do robotic vacuum cleaners last?
    • A: The lifespan differs depending upon the brand, model, and usage. With proper upkeep, an excellent quality robotic vacuum cleaner can last for several years (typically 3-5 years).
  • Q: Are robotic vacuum cleaners loud?
    • A: Generally, robotic vacuums are quieter than conventional vacuums. Sound levels vary across models, so check the decibel ranking if noise is an issue.
  • Q: Can robotic vacuum cleaners tidy stairs?
    • A: No, basic robotic vacuum can not climb up stairs. You would need to by hand carry them to clean different levels of your home, or consider a different handheld or traditional vacuum for stairs.
  • Q: How much do robotic vacuum cleaners expense in the UK?
    • A: Prices range from around ₤ 150 for fundamental models to over ₤ 1000 for high-end designs with innovative functions like self-emptying and LiDAR navigation.
